"A five-day mini-festival presented by the Dublin-based Prime Collective kicks off on Tuesday, 22 November, in Dublin’s city centre. It continues until Saturday, 26 November.

The mini-festival will highlight the wide range of jazz and improvised music that is already happening in Dublin, as well as showcasing bands and musicians from Leeds, Cork and Paris.

Highlights are Roller Trio (pictured) on Thursday in the Mercantile bar on Dame street — a young Leeds-based trio who have just signed to the F-ire label, based in London, a triple-bill of hard-hitting and funky Irish groups on Tuesday in Sweeney’s bar and Concrete Soup on the Saturday night — an evening of improvised music curated by trombonist Colm O’Hara in the Back Loft, Augustine St. All concerts start at 8pm.

The two busiest days in the schedule are Tuesday, which sees three concurrent events, and Thursday with two simultaneous concerts.
